Division I Transformation Committee’s final report and next steps

DI Council expected to vote on additional legislative proposals

The Division I Board of Directors will receive and discuss the Division I Transformation Committee's final report and recommendations at the 2023 NCAA Convention in San Antonio. The board will meet Thursday, Jan. 12, to consider those concepts. If approved, many of the concepts will be referred to respective Division I committees to create specific proposals to move those recommendations forward for implementation no later than August.

The Transformation Committee was appointed by the Division I Board of Directors to lead the division's modernization efforts after the adoption of a new NCAA constitution during the 2022 NCAA Convention in Indianapolis. 

The Division I Council and the Presidential Forum will have the opportunity to provide feedback during their meetings Wednesday. On Thursday, Division I members also will discuss those recommendations and the board's actions during the Division I Issues Forum.

Division I Council

The Division I Council is scheduled to vote on several proposals from the 2022-23 legislative cycle at its meeting Wednesday. 

The proposals include:

  • Changing rules for official and unofficial visits, including removing limits for the number of schools at which a recruit can take an official visit (with a limit of one per school, unless there is a coaching change).
  • Adjustments to athletics personnel definitions and limits, including potential increases to coaching limits for baseball, softball and ice hockey.

The Council also will consider a proposal that would eliminate test score requirements for immediate eligibility for incoming freshman student-athletes. This recommendation stems from the NCAA Standardized Test Score Task Force, a specialized group charged with reviewing initial-eligibility requirements. 

Another proposal under consideration by the Division I Council would add stunt to the Emerging Sports for Women program in Division I and establish legislation related to membership, financial aid and playing and practice seasons. In December, the NCAA Committee on Women's Athletics recommended that the divisional governance bodies refer their proposals to add stunt as an emerging sport for women back to the Committee on Women's Athletics. The latest recommendation is based on a review of new information regarding stunt. 

Other Division I standing committees

The Division I Football Oversight Committee, Strategic Vision and Planning Committee, Women's Basketball Oversight Committee, Student-Athlete Experience Committee, Competition Oversight Committee and the Men's Basketball Oversight Committee all are slated to meet Tuesday. 

The national Division I Student-Athlete Advisory Committee will meet Jan. 11-13.
